@Blazej_09601 it's an interesting scenario and I'll try to keep this as simple as possible.
You can pair two Apple Watches to an iPhone however only one Apple Watch can be active at any particular time. You can go in and deactivate / activate each smartwatch on the phone as you want to use them but you can't use the two watches simultaneously.
If you have two seperate numbers on eligible plans then you could purchase a smartwatch add on for each however if they were in the same phone I wouldn't be able to confirm how this works with Apple and you'd also be only able to use one smartwatch at a time regardless.

@Blazej_09601 I understand what you are attempting to do but I don't believe setting up another account is going to work in this instance.
If you had two Bill Pay plans then you could purchase an Smartwatch Add on for both plans and you could use both of these SIM cards in your phone provided they supported Dual SIM. The issue that you may run into is that you can only have one watch connected to one phone at any time so while Watch A is connected to the phone and using the cellular then Watch B would remain offline until you were able to connect it to the phone again.
Apple may be able to advise you on this further however I wouldn't personally recommend doing it as I can't guarantee it would be as seamless as expected as the Smartwatch sharer is set up to be one Smartwatch per phone.
